And even though the author probably didn't intend it, the translation is fitting otherwise too, since a 'magic bullet' both has roots in Germanic folklore as missiles of supernatural accuracy...and has the modern meaning along the lines 'specialized guaranteed cure for a [specific problem/issue/pathogen/what-have-you]'.

The 魔弾の王 title was only used for the legend that dated way further back than the Zchted founding legend. Tigre's (and his army's) titles so far have been nothing but references to stars.
